On today’s episode, I chat with Jurassic World: Camp Cretaceous composer, Leo Birenberg (PEN15, Cobra Kai). We talk about his Jurassic Park origin story, why Camp Cretaceous doesn’t have a traditional theme song, looking forward to season 2 of the show, and more!
